Output 750131aeb4a9c353cc067f48a3fa6b97d43fb30ae4c5a8fa2e8e5b6693be89ad:0
- value
- 21284566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95a62baae8c848aabe904dc1eb3ee7b2806e2c3e OP_EQUAL
- address
- 3FLHfrsBGVhChvGQRfAyA1fmyLJ5gA3qGr
- transaction
- 750131aeb4a9c353cc067f48a3fa6b97d43fb30ae4c5a8fa2e8e5b6693be89ad